Hash Company has launched over thirty models of the PCII series single parameter water quality analyzer - the PCII series pocket colorimeter, which is not only suitable for field water quality testing, but also for laboratory water quality analysis. This series of products is pre programmed by Hash Company according to internationally standardized testing methods, and the standard curve is stored in a single parameter water quality analyzer. It undergoes strict calibration and verification before leaving the factory in a standardized laboratory. This series of single parameter water quality analyzers can measure one or more parameters and directly display the measurement results.
● Convenient to carry: weighs only 230 grams;
Excellent waterproof performance: can still be used normally after being immersed in about 1 meter of water for up to 30 minutes;
● Data recording function: allows users to store and call 10 nearest data points without manually recording data;
● Large screen display:
(1) Equipped with background lighting function, it is convenient to view the readings on the screen when the light is dim;
(2) The battery level display icon can indicate the battery level, making it easy to replace the battery in a timely manner.

Wavelength: Different models have differences
Luminescence measurement range: 0-2.5 ABS
Power supply: No. 7 alkaline battery
Weight: 230g
Operating environment: 0-50 ℃; 0-90% relative humidity
Protection level: IP67
